Common Mistakes and How to Avoid Them

The pitfalls that show up most often in real projects, with the cause and the practical fix.

Mistake Why It Happens Practical Fix
1. Hook cleanliness ignored Contamination Clean hooks
2. Masking reused past life Overspray Renew per drawing
3. Booth air unbalanced Overspray and dirt Check airflow
4. Gun maintenance skipped Atomisation drifts Service on schedule
5. No gloss master Judged by opinion Keep the master
6. Cure profile stale Gloss drift Re-profile per season
7. Skipping the standard checklist Steps skipped, quality varies Follow the rack painting checklist every time
8. Guessing instead of asking Faults compound silently Ask the senior before guessing
9. No shift log History lost at hand-over Log readings, actions and faults

Working Data & Formula Notes

Working data - junior rack painting

Reference values for rack painting zinc hardware.

Component / Parameter Working Value / Role What Changes Mean (annotation)
Distance 150-300 mm Sags close, dry spray far.
Film 15-30 um Under-build fails coverage.
Cure Metal temperature The film cures by metal heat.
Masking Per drawing Protects threads and features.
Hooks Clean per schedule Contamination lands on parts.

Implementation Cases

Case 1 - contact marks on the face

Situation. Rack-painted buckles showed hook marks on the front face.

Approach. The junior hung parts on the back edge and masked the contact area.

Outcome. Marks disappeared.

Case 2 - overspray on threads

Situation. Threaded fittings came out with paint in the threads.

Approach. Masking was added per the drawing.

Outcome. Threads stayed clean.

Frequently Asked Questions

Where should I hang parts?

On hidden or non-critical faces. Hook marks show after cure.

Why mask?

To protect threads, logos and features per the drawing. Overspray is a reject.

What distance should I hold?

150-300 mm per paint. Close sags; far dries.

How do I avoid runs?

Thin, overlapping passes. Heavy coats run.

How do I know the film is right?

Use a wet film gauge and verify cured film.

How do I cure?

By metal temperature profile per the paint TDS.

Why clean hooks?

Dirty hooks carry contamination onto parts.

What do I check first?

First articles: film, marks, colour and cure.
